Physical-mechanical performance of the concrete produced with fiber addition jute plant in the partial replacement of Portland cement in 0.5% and 1.0%
Descrição
This work presents a feasibility study of the use of Jute fibers (Corchurus capsularis) as
reinforcement in the partial replacement of Portland cement in conventional concrete with fck of 25
MPa. For this, during the study stages, numerous laboratory tests were carried out with the purpose
of characterizing the materials used in this research, both for the small aggregates and for the
Portland cement and the proposed fibers. The objective after the characterization of the materials
was to investigate the physical and mechanical behavior of the concrete specimens molded for the
analysis of rupture at 7 and 28 days of curing and water absorption, divided into three different
groups, a molding being the pilot with 0.0% addition of fibers denominated as reference and another
two with different percentages extracted from the consumption of total cement used in concrete test
specimens under analysis, being group 2 with 0.5% and group 3 with 1, 0% fiber.
